- System Requirements
| Component | Minimum: | Recommended: |
|---|---|---|
| Processor | Intel Core i5-4590/AMD FX 8350 equivalent or better | Intel Core i5-4590/AMD FX 8350 equivalent or better |
| Memory | 4 GB RAM | 4 GB RAM |
| Graphics | NVIDIA GeForce GTX 970, AMD Radeon R9 290 equivalent or better | NVIDIA GeForce GTX 1060, AMD Radeon RX 480 equivalent or better |
| Storage | 1 GB available space | 1 GB available space |
| Additional Notes | HDMI 1.4, DisplayPort 1.2 or newer, 1x USB 2.0 or newer, HTC Vive and touch controllers or Oculus Rift S and controllers | HDMI 1.4, DisplayPort 1.2 or newer, 1x USB 2.0 or newer, HTC Vive and touch controllers or Oculus Rift S and controllers |
